Understanding Different Customization Methods

Knowing the right customization techniques will help you come up with quality and unique products for your clothing line, specifically t-shirts, sweatshirts, pants, hoodies, and other astrology-based attires concerning zodiac signs. Effective techniques are:

Sublimation Printing

Overview: In sublimation printing, the dye is transferred to fabric due to heat and results in vibrant colors, and durable designs, an effective technique for polyester fabrics.

Advantages:

Vivid Colors: Vibrant, full-color designs.
Durable: Dye becomes a part of the fabric; it won't fade or crack.
Comfort: It maintains the smooth texture of the fabric, and doesn't add bulk.

Best for:

  • Polyester t-shirts and sweatshirts; detailed Zodiac sign designs; all-over prints.

Appliqué

Overview: This method sews pieces of fabric onto any garment, giving designs or images that are noteworthy. The applique thus achieved gives depth and has a textural feel, setting any clothing apart.

Advantages:

Unique Aesthetics: Most especially it creates a unique homemade-like appearance
Durability: Patches sewed on with fabric are strong and long-lasting
Composition: Mix and match of fabrics with different colors may be utilized

Best For:

  • Hoodies and sweatshirts that include custom-made astrology-based zodiac signs.
  • Logo and motif designs, both custom-made, in unique, textured designs.

Vinyl Cutting

Overview: Designs are cut out of colored vinyl sheets and applied to the garment using heat. This process produces very fine lines, clean and bright.

Advantages:

Precise: Done in detail to bring about accurate designs.
Varied: Vinyl is available in a wide variety of colors and finishes—from matte to metallic.
Strong: Vinyl designs do not chip or fade easily.

Best For:

  • T-shirts and hoodies containing bold graphics of the zodiac signs.
  • Custom text with basic, eye-catching designs.

Patch Embellishment

Overview: Patch embellishment involves creating embroidered or printed patches that are sewn or ironed onto garments. This method is great for adding durable and versatile custom elements to your clothing.

The patch embellishment method, in all, includes creating an embroidered or printed patch that might then be sewn or ironed onto garments. This is a great way to offer your items of clothing robust, versatile personalized elements.

Advantages:

Durability: These are quite securely attached to the garment and can always be replaced if they wear out.
Customization: Different designs can easily be provided for the twelve zodiac signs.
Versatility: It works on various types of day-to-day T-shirts.

Best For:

  • Sweatshirts and hoodies with zodiac patches, custom logo designs, and astrology-themed designs.

Digital Heat Seal Transfers

Overview: Digital heat seal transfers are a means of attaining designs on specially made transfer paper through digital printing and applying them to the fabric using heat. It's the most fitting solution for colored and detailed designs.

Advantages:

High Detail: Clear and colored designs are possible.
Flexibility: Can be prepared for sample quantities or big orders.
Quick Turnaround: Quick production with minimum setup needed.

Best For:

  • T-shirts and pants that feature astrology sign designs with great detail.
  • Custom design for limited-edition astrology collections.

Choose a method that suits your design complexity, budget, and desired outcome.

Step-by-Step Guide to Customizing T-Shirts

Step 1: Designing Your T-Shirt

The very first step to creating a custom t-shirt is designing and conceptualizing your artwork, such as brainstorming and finding an idea ranging from personal interest to forcing the trend or self-referential ideas.

Digital Design: Put the design into actuality with design software like Adobe Illustrator or Canva. Be sure that the artwork is scalable and print-ready for it to be unified with accuracy.

Mock-Up:
Mock up how your design will look on a t-shirt and see what the result will look like. Keep moving things around until it feels just right—play with size, placement, and color.

Step 2: Preparing for Printing or Embroidery

Once you have finalized a design, it is now time to prepare it for printing or embroidery:

Screen Printing: Coat your screens with emulsion, then shoot the stencils for however many colors you have. Set up your printing station with ink, squeegees, and, of course, your drying area.

Heat Transfer: Design on transfer paper or vinyl and print through a printer or plotter. Cut and weed the design, then apply it to the T-shirt using a heat press.

Direct-to-Garment Printing: Make a set-up for the design in the DTG printer, followed by adjusting the settings according to the type of fabric and complexity of the design. The printing on the t-shirt will show vibrant, intricate details.

Embroidery: Hoop your T-shirt, stabilizing the fabric to inhibit further stretch. Load up your design into your embroidery machine and set up your threads and needles. Stitch into your fabric with precision and attention to detail.

Step 3: Applying Your Design

Follow the exact instructions given to get the best results for each way of customization:

Screen Printing: Ink is pushed through the stencil onto the T-shirt; even pressure in smooth strokes gives crisp, vivid prints.

Heat Transfer: Position your design on the T-shirt, then apply heat and pressure using a heat press with the manufacturer's instructions. Peel off the transfer paper or vinyl to show your design.

Direct-to-Garment Printing: Directly print on the fabric by setting up the settings on your printer to have the most vibrant color possible along with highly minute details of saturation of the ink.

Embroidery: The design will then be sewn into the fabric using an embroidery machine. Trim loose threads and inspect the finished embroidery for quality and accuracy.

Step 4: Care of T-Shirts with Custom Designs

In order not to ruin the great looks of your custom t-shirts, here are simple care instructions:

Washi: Always wash your T-shirts inside out in cold water with mild detergent. Avoid bleach or other harsh chemicals since they are known to cause fading and sometimes even damage the design.

Drying: Air dry or use the low heat setting on the dryer to maintain your prints or embroidery.

Storage: Keep your folded t-shirts in a dry, cool place away from direct sunlight, so that they may not fade or discolor with time.
